Paper Mache Bowls

What You’ll Need:
Old newspapers or scrap paper
Flour and water for the paste
A bowl to use as a mold
Paints and brushes for decorating
A mixing bowl and spoon
💡 Inspiration
Step-by-Step:
Stir together equal parts flour and water until you have a smooth paste. This will be the glue that holds your bowl together.
Tear up some old newspapers into strips. You’ll be layering these over your mold to create the bowl shape.
Turn a bowl upside down, and start layering the paper strips dipped in the paste over it. Make sure to cover the entire surface, adding several layers for strength.
Once you’ve got enough layers, let the paper mache dry completely. This might take a few hours or overnight.
After it’s dry, carefully remove your paper mache bowl from the mold. Now, it’s time to paint and decorate!
